A 21-aa standard natural multi-activity (Antibacterial, Anticancer, Antifungal, and other sources) peptide sequence curated from AntiBP3, dbAMP, DRAMP, and other sources, with an available 3D structural model.
Sequence
GLFGVLAKVAAHVVPAIAEHF
